Transaction d8debd23606e2edec9e5da146aa7882360a86f2d3893f548ac919aac849a7ed7

block
6ebf4c5291566cc2a80fb3e9b800862c2062db2240d71f74b93d1eb646cc6b62

1 Input

17 Outputs